This code converts the software correlator output into an aips++ MeasurementSet. The MeasurementSet can be analysed and postprocessed using the standard set of tools that is also used for the EVN hardware correlator at JIVE. Existing tools can also be used to convert the MeasurementSet into FITS for use with classic AIPS.
